Khajuri Jati is a village located in Fatehabad Block of Fatehabad district in Haryana. Positioned in rural region of Fatehabad district of Haryana, it is one among the 47 villages of Fatehabad Block of Fatehabad district. As per the administration records, the village number of Khajuri Jati is 60440. The village has 661 houses.
According to Census 2011, Khajuri Jati's population is 3411. Out of this, 1792 are males whereas the females count 1619 here. This village has 430 kids in the age bracket of 0-6 years. Out of this 229 are boys and 201 are girls.
Literacy ratio in Khajuri Jati village is 61%. 2103 out of total 3411 population is literate here. In males the literacy rate is 70% as 1257 males out of total 1792 are educated while female literacy rate is 52% as 846 out of total 1619 females are educated in this Village.
The dark part is that illiteracy rate of Khajuri Jati village is 38%. Here 1308 out of total 3411 people are illiterate. Male illiteracy ratio here is 29% as 535 males out of total 1792 are illiterate. Among the females the illiteracy rate is 47% and 773 out of total 1619 females are illiterate in this village.
The count of occupied people of Khajuri Jati village is 1005 yet 2406 are non-working. And out of 1005 working people 595 peoples are totally dependent on agriculture.
